y2="14"></line></svg></button></div></div></div></a></figure></div><p>We&#8217;ve all heard lots of things about the consumer journey, and why it&#8217;s important. But what is it?</p><p>Well, the idea was born as far back as 1898 by someone named Elias St. Elmo Lewis. They don&#8217;t make names like that anymore. An advertising pioneer, Lewis wanted to bring scientific rigor to selling products, and in those early days of industrializing, the challenge wasn&#8217;t building a brand or relentless competition. It was consumer ignorance.</p><p>New products were flooding the market, and the public needed to be educated before they could be persuaded.</p><p>Lewis developed a model to guide a prospect to a sale. The consumer journey, in other words. You&#8217;re probably familiar with Lewis&#8217; model: AIDA (Attention, Interest, Desire, Action). As fit the media market of those days, it was linear.</p><ul><li><p><strong>Attention:</strong> The first crucial step. If you fail here, Lewis argued, nothing else matters.</p></li><li><p><strong>Interest:</strong> Transform fleeting awareness into deeper curiosity about the product&#8217;s features, utility, etc.</p></li><li><p><strong>Desire:</strong> Go beyond the rational mind (&#8221;I get it&#8221;) and tap the power of emotions (&#8221;I want it&#8221;). It&#8217;s where brand building starts.</p></li><li><p><strong>Action:</strong> If all the other stages are done right, Lewis felt consumer action was a natural, inevitable consequence.</p></li></ul><p>Today, more than a century later, the AIDA model is still in marketing textbooks. It aligns with behavioral psychology. It&#8217;s core. <br><br>Until today.<br><br>The chatbots blew it up.</p><p>Perplexity, Claude, Gemini, they don&#8217;t take the consumer journey. go backward for a moment.</p><p>I remember clearly when <strong>Dropbox</strong> decided to move off third-party cloud infrastructure and start running its own servers. At the time, a lot of very smart people in Silicon Valley said Dropbox was making a mistake. Their argument was that Dropbox wasn&#8217;t really a storage company; it was a UX company. Storage was a commodity. The interface was the value.That argument never made sense to me.</p><p>Files still have to live somewhere. And if that &#8220;somewhere&#8221; is owned by a third party, like <strong>Amazon Web Services</strong>, then that third party controls pricing, terms, access, and ultimately your margins. They can change the rules whenever they want and even compete with you down the road.</p><p>Dropbox understood that early. Storage wasn&#8217;t a feature. It was core to the product. And that decision is a big reason Dropbox is still around despite pressure from <strong>Google Drive</strong> and <strong>Microsoft OneDrive</strong>. They weren&#8217;t just defending a UI. They were defending control.</p><p>That same lesson is repeating itself now, just at a different layer of the stack.</p><h3><strong>The LLM Platform Trap</strong></h3><p>I think in 2026 we&#8217;re going to see a lot of AI-first startups struggle, not because AI demand slows down, but because too many of them are built on top of platforms they don&#8217;t control.</p><p>Take a hypothetical construction software company. General contractors love it. It automates billing, compliance, and change orders. Real value. But if 90 percent of that value is coming from calls to <strong>OpenAI</strong>, Gemini, or another LLM provider, then who actually controls the business?</p><p>The LLM provider controls pricing. They control performance. They control output quality. They control whether features stay available. And at some point, they can decide they don&#8217;t need your application at all because they can offer the same functionality directly.</p><p>You didn&#8217;t just build a product. You trained the platform that might replace you.</p><p>This is why VCs are now asking a harder question than &#8220;is this AI-powered?&#8221; They&#8217;re asking: if the underlying platform changes its economics or strategy, what happens to you?</p><p>Brand and distribution help. Having tens of thousands of users helps. But those things don&#8217;t always protect you when the intelligence layer you depend on is owned by someone else.</p><h3><strong>Flipping the Pyramid</strong></h3><p>What worked five years ago doesn&#8217;t work anymore. Back then, companies built the LLM first and trusted that value would emerge later. That made sense when the model itself was the breakthrough. Today, that playbook is mostly gone.</p><p>If you&#8217;re building now, you have to flip the pyramid. You build value first. You own a workflow deeply. You control data that&#8217;s proprietary and hard to replicate. You become embedded in how someone actually runs their business. Only after that do you start pulling more of the intelligence stack in-house.</p><p>Yes, that eventually means training or owning more of your own models. That&#8217;s expensive. But capital follows value. If you&#8217;ve proven that you control something essential, investors will fund the infrastructure required to defend it. Anything else is just renting intelligence.</p><h3><strong>The AI Layer</strong></h3><p>This brings me to something I&#8217;m hearing more and more in conversations with operators and advisors: the idea of owning your AI layer.</p><p>For years, companies outsourced core systems to platforms like <strong>Salesforce</strong> or <strong>SAP</strong>. Those were systems of record. They stored data. They ran workflows. That was fine. AI is different.</p><p>Once AI starts influencing pricing, underwriting, customer interactions, forecasting, or operations, it stops being a passive system and starts becoming the way your company thinks. That&#8217;s not something you want living entirely inside someone else&#8217;s platform.</p><p>You can use an LLM provider for compute and modeling power. That&#8217;s infrastructure. That should be swappable. What matters is that the intelligence layer&#8212;the workflows, logic, prompts, proprietary data, and decision frameworks, lives inside your organization. You should be able to change LLM providers without rewriting your business.</p><p>If switching models breaks your core workflows, then you don&#8217;t own your AI layer. Someone else does. This is the same realization Dropbox had years ago. Storage wasn&#8217;t just a backend detail. It was mission-critical. So they owned it.</p><p>AI is moving into that same category now. Not as a feature or plugin. But as core infrastructure. And the companies that survive the next wave won&#8217;t be the ones with the flashiest demos. They&#8217;ll be the ones that decided early what they had to own and built their businesses around defending it.</p><div class="captioned-button-wrap"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://www.seoisdead.com/p/the-ai-layer-and-platform-dependence?utm_source=substack&utm_medium=email&utm_content=share&action=share&quot;,&quot;text&quot;:&quot;Share&quot;}" data-component-name="CaptionedButtonToDOM"><div class="preamble"><p class="cta-caption">Thanks for reading SEO is Dead! y2="14"></line></svg></button></div></div></div></a></figure></div><p>For nearly three decades, Google Search was one of the greatest business models ever built&#8212;not because it monetized everything, but because it didn&#8217;t have to.</p><p>Most people don&#8217;t realize this, but roughly 80% of all Google searches never showed an ad. Only about 20% of searches had any commercial intent at all. And even when ads were shown, the overall click-through rate hovered around 3%. That means Google only made money on a tiny fraction of total searches.</p><p>In almost any other business, that math would be terrifying. For Google, it was magic.</p><p>Why? Because the cost of serving a search was absurdly low. A traditional Google search&#8212;pre-AI&#8212;was estimated to cost fractions of a penny. Google wasn&#8217;t generating intelligence in real time. It was returning ranked links from an already-indexed corpus, using an algorithm it had amortized over decades. The marginal cost was so close to zero that it barely mattered whether a search monetized or not.</p><p>That&#8217;s the first tail. And Google was ruthless about protecting it.</p><p>In the early days, Google made two very deliberate choices that most people forget. First, it showed only ten blue links&#8212;no images, no rich media, no fluff. Why? Speed and bandwidth efficiency. Every extra asset slowed page load and increased cost. Google optimized for instant answers over visual richness long before &#8220;page speed&#8221; was fashionable.</p><p>Second, Google didn&#8217;t rely on off-the-shelf infrastructure. It built custom servers to power crawling, indexing, and search results. Not because it was sexy&#8212;but because it let them squeeze every dollar of efficiency out of the system. This wasn&#8217;t just good engineering; it was economic warfare. Google understood that if you control cost at massive scale, you can afford an enormous non-monetized long tail.</p><p>That&#8217;s why the model worked.</p><p>Google could support billions of free searches because the tail was cheap. And when monetization did happen&#8212;insurance, legal, auto, travel&#8212;it was extraordinarily valuable. A few dollars here, ten or fifteen dollars there, multiplied across scale. Low cost, rare but lucrative monetization, infinite leverage.</p><p>Now enter AI.</p><p>When Google introduced AI Overviews, everything changed. Suddenly, search wasn&#8217;t just retrieval&#8212;it was generation. Every query required real-time intelligence powered by Gemini, layered with context, safety, and reasoning. That shift didn&#8217;t just change UX. It blew up the cost structure.</p><p>It&#8217;s widely estimated that a search with an AI Overview costs 5&#8211;10&#215; more than a traditional Google search. At the same time, Google is knowingly cannibalizing some of its own ad real estate by placing AI answers above commercial links.</p><p>That tells you something important.</p><p>Google is not doing this casually. It&#8217;s doing it defensively. Users are being trained&#8212;by LLMs&#8212;to want answers, not links. And Google knows that if it remains just a link engine while others become answer engines, it loses relevance. So it&#8217;s accepting higher compute costs and short-term revenue pressure to protect long-term dominance.</p><p>Which brings us to the second tail.</p><p>LLMs live in a fundamentally different economic world.</p><p>Unlike classic search, every LLM interaction has real, material cost. A short answer is cheap. Anything meaningful&#8212;long reasoning, file uploads, document summaries, images, multi-step agent workflows&#8212;gets expensive fast. Compared to classic Google search, LLM queries are often 10&#215; to 100&#215; more expensive per interaction.</p><p>There is no free long tail here. The long tail of Google is dead!</p><p>Every question costs money. Every follow-up compounds it. Intelligence isn&#8217;t pre-indexed&#8212;it&#8217;s generated on demand, every time.</p><p>That&#8217;s the second tail.</p><p>And while companies like Google and Microsoft can afford to live here&#8212;at least for now&#8212;most others cannot.
